Linux quick-start guide

  1. Build the image (one-time, ~10–15 min due to submodule compilation):
docker compose build
  1. Allow the container to connect to your host display (Linux):
xhost +local:docker
  1. Run the simulator:
docker compose up -d
  1. Place files on the simulated MicroSD by copying them into the named volume's MicroSD/ subdirectory, or by using a bind-mount override in a docker-compose.override.yml.

Key design decisions

  • Ubuntu 22.04 base: Explicitly supported by the README; avoids needing ubuntu24_mpy.patch
  • pysdl2-dll pip package: Provides the SDL2 runtime library in Python without relying solely on the system libsdl2
  • VOLUME for unix/work: Persists simulated MicroSD, virtual disk, and wallet settings across container restarts
  • ENTRYPOINT + empty CMD: Allows passing extra simulator.py flags via docker compose run coldcard-simulator --flag
  • restart: "no" The simulator is interactive; it should not auto-restart on exit
